Details on results:
The test solution concentration of 100 mg/L (nominal) was presumably above the solubilityof KY-ET in water (0.002 mg/L). This test concentration (limit test level) showed no toxicity towards sludge microorganisms (1 and 4% inhibition).
Results with reference substance (positive control):
- Results with reference substance valid? yes
- Relevant effect levels: 30% inhibition at 3.2 mg/L, 63% inhibition at 10 mg/L, 89% at 32 mg/L.

Executive summary:

An activated sludge respiration inhibition study was performed according to OECD 209. The limit test was performed at nominal 100 mg/L, which is significantly above the solubility of KY-ET (0.002 mg/L). This test concentration showed no toxicity towards sludge microorganisms (1 and 4% inhibition). Therefore the nominal EC50 value is > 100 mg/L.
